Question
which will decrease the kinetic energy (energy of motion) of water molecules?
remove some of the water
add heat
adding more water
place the water in the freezer
Brief Explanations
To determine which action decreases the kinetic energy of water molecules, we analyze each option:
- Removing some water: This affects the amount of water but not the motion of individual molecules. Kinetic energy per molecule remains unchanged.
- Adding heat: Adding heat increases the temperature, which increases the kinetic energy of molecules as they move faster.
- Adding more water: Similar to removing water, this changes the quantity but not the motion of each molecule's kinetic energy.
- Placing water in the freezer: A freezer lowers the temperature. Temperature is related to the average kinetic energy of molecules; lower temperature means lower kinetic energy as molecules slow down.
